CHRISTMAS may still be many weeks away, but a new pop-up shop selling festive cards for charity is set to open.
The Cards for Good Causes charity shop will open in Droitwich on Tuesday, October 25, to raise money for a variety of good causes.
Staffed by a team of volunteers, the shop is part of a network of 300 temporary shops run by Cards for Good Causes, a multi-charity Christmas card organisation.
The charity represents more than 250 charities including Cancer Research UK, Barnardo’s and local charities such as Worcester Wildlife.
The shop can be found at the Heritage Centre in St Richard's House, Victoria Square, and is open Monday to Friday, from 10am until 4pm, and Saturday, from 10am to 1.30pm.
